Linking Channels for Surround Pan

For stereo input channels (17 to 24), or mono input channels configured as a
stereo pair, you can select one of eight patterns and move both sounds
together. The following illustration shows how the two channels are
panned with the various patterns and trajectories.
Trajectory
Pattern
Note: ST LINK settings are not stored in channel library programs. So when a
channel program is recalled and the destination channel is using ST LINK, the
surround settings of the other linked channel are changed to match. Also, when the
surround settings of a stereo channel are stored, only the settings of the selected
channel are stored.
By default, ST LINK is turned on for stereo channels. Note that if just the ST
LINK parameter is turned off, it is possible to overwrite the pan
movements of the other channel during subsequent automix recording.
